After your offer is accepted, you will enter the due diligence period. This step ensures the property is in good condition and legally clear.
Key steps include:
This stage protects your investment and ensures there are no unexpected issues.
Closing in Puerto Rico is handled through a notary attorney, who prepares and records the official deed.
During closing, you will:
Once completed, you officially become a property owner in Puerto Rico.
